Output 31ab615edc7bbee036dc1991663ad80bb40a5e94d6926350dfce23499eb5260b:4

value
39819
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1062629a3bbf0beccfae3cc97d69b82aad631b1c39155dd48bcf466f97045c3b
address
bc1pzp3x9x3mhu97enaw8nyh66dc92kkxxcu8y24m4ytearxl9cytsasgq44dj
transaction
31ab615edc7bbee036dc1991663ad80bb40a5e94d6926350dfce23499eb5260b
confirmations
111542
spent
true